Requirements

  • Hold or have held an EASA ATPL or CPL licence.
  • Hold or have held either: FAA instructor certificate, or
  • Part-FCL instructor certificate (EASA), or
  • Equivalent 900(c) qualification aligned with ATO training courses.
  • Minimum of three years' experience delivering or managing instructor training within an ATO and/or AOC environment.
  • Extensive experience in training MPA pilots for professional licences and/or associated ratings.
  • Experience in Multi-Crew Cooperation (MCC) and Crew Resource Management (CRM).
  • Working knowledge of relevant regulations (e.g., Part-FCL/ORA, CFR Part 61, 135, 142).
  • Strong leadership and influencing skills, with the ability to coach and develop training leaders.
  • Demonstrated ability to analyse and interpret performance data (OKRs, KPIs, audits).
  • Excellent organisational skills with the ability to manage multiple initiatives simultaneously.
  • Strong communication skills, with the ability to liaise effectively across global and regional stakeholders.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Teams, Word, and PowerPoint.
  • Ability to work across cultures, time zones, and diverse training environments.
  • Experience across multiple domains (e.g., BAT, CAT, FTO).
  • Experience supporting multiple business units and managing complex training ecosystems.
  • Proven ability to implement and harmonise global standardisation policies across diverse environments.
  • Experience in regional or multi-site leadership roles.
  • Strong capability in influencing senior stakeholders and driving strategic initiatives.
  • Demonstrated experience building a culture of excellence and continuous improvement.

⠀ Join our Business Aviation Training Centre in Vienna (Schwechat) as Regional Training Standards Manager , supporting CAE's global Civil Aviation Training team. Our newly opened centre hosts state‑of‑the‑art Full Flight Simulators, including the G550, PH100/300, Global 7500, and Global 6000 Vision, with capacity to expand to nine simulators. This 8,000‑sqm facility is designed to provide the most advanced pilot training environment in Central Europe. In this role, you will: Provide regional leadership, coordination, and oversight of multiple Local Training Standards Leads to ensure consistent implementation of global standards and harmonised training practices across all Training Centres. Coach, guide, and evaluate Local Training Standards Leads to maintain consistency, quality, and regulatory compliance. Translate global initiatives into actionable regional plans and support Training Centre Leaders in customer and internal training delivery. Monitor, analyse, and report on regional OKRs, KPIs, and performance metrics related to instructor qualifications, observation programmes (IPPM/DOI), audit findings, and training quality. Identify regional trends, risks, and opportunities, and provide data-driven recommendations to the Global Head of Standards. Oversee delivery of Civil Global IDT and other instructor training activities, ensuring alignment in courseware, methodology, and delivery standards. Act as a strategic advisor, aligning global standardisation policies with regional operational requirements and supporting regulatory interpretation. Develop and facilitate structured regional governance, ensuring effective communication between Local Training Standards Leads, Training Standards Specialists, Training Managers, Centre Leaders, and global leadership. Support efficiency in instructor time to qualification by collaborating with Operations to align business needs, regulatory requirements, and training delivery. Promote a regional culture of excellence, collaboration, knowledge sharing, and continuous improvement across the Standards community. Manage responsibilities across multiple training centres, including remote leadership across different time zones and cultures.
